About the role
You are a strategic and execution-focused Product Manager who will own and lead the development of the B2B Partner Portal for a newly launched business vertical of EduFund, called Vittam. This portal will serve as the central hub for onboarding, engagement, performance tracking, and support for distribution/channel/affiliate partners. Your responsibilities will include: - Product Ownership & Strategy (30%): - Define and drive the product roadmap for the Partner Portal aligned with business and channel partner goals. - Gather and prioritize product requirements by collaborating with sales, partnerships, operations, and external partners. - Develop a deep understanding of partner needs, pain points, and workflows to inform product decisions. - Execution & Delivery (40%): - Lead cross-functional teams (engineering, design, QA) to deliver scalable, high-performance portal features such as onboarding, reporting dashboards, payout tracking, and communication modules. - Own and manage the product backlog, write clear PRDs, user stories, and acceptance criteria. - Track and drive adoption, usage, and performance metrics post-launch. - Stakeholder & Partner Collaboration (20%): - Act as the voice of the partner internally, ensuring their needs are reflected in the platform. - Collaborate with marketing, support, and training teams to improve partner enablement and engagement. - Support internal teams in go-to-market strategies, partner communications, and feedback loops. - Continuous Improvement & Insights (10%): - Use data (quantitative + qualitative) to iterate and improve the portal continuously. - Stay updated on competitor offerings and partner portal best practices. Your qualifications should include: - 24 years of total experience with at least 2+ years in product management, preferably in fintech. - Proven track record of building and scaling partner/affiliate/agent platforms or enterprise self-serve portals. - Strong understanding of API-based integrations, CRM systems, and reporting tools. - Comfortable working with data dashboards (e.g., Mixpanel, GA, Looker) and writing clear BRDs/PRDs. -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ills. - User-centric mindset with the ability to balance partner experience with business goals. Preferred qualifications include experience with channel sales, partner lifecycle management, or onboarding journeys, exposure to low-code/no-code tools or internal admin platforms, and an MBA or equivalent from a reputed institution is a plus but not mandatory.
